Sod Poodles sounding more like the top name

I’m hearing from a number of longtime Texas Panhandle residents — many of them lifelong residents — who say the same thing.

Sod Poodles is not another name for prairie dogs.

Yet the owners of the minor-league baseball team that will play ball in Amarillo, Texas, beginning next April might be leaning toward naming their team the Sod Poodles.

And it’s over the apparent objections of those who contend that the finalist name — despite contentions from team owners — really has no historical reference to the critters that still populate the Caprock.

I’ve done a 180 on the name. The first time I heard the list of finalist names … I hated all of them. I might even have hated Sod Poodles the most. The name I hate the most at the moment, though, is Jerky.

Now? I understand the marketing ploy that the Elmore Group — owners of the team that is moving to Amarillo — is trying to use. They want a cute name. They want a name that will have fans talking about the label, the team. They want to gin up interest among baseball fans.

I think they have accomplished their mission.

For the record, I want the Amarillo Sod Poodles to play hardball next year.
